Psalm 57:2

I will cry unto God most high; unto God that performeth all things for me.

KJV

Read in Psalm 57

Meaning

The verse grounds the plea for refuge in God’s character and activity. The psalmist does not claim control of the outcome; he appeals to the God who acts on his behalf.

Calling to God Most High

The opening movement turns immediate danger into prayer for mercy, refuge, and help from the God whose steadfast love and faithfulness can reach the threatened worshiper.

Read carefully

The psalm expresses confidence in God’s faithful agency, not a blank guarantee for the worshiper’s preferred plan or timetable.
